Choosing the Best UHF Antenna: Your Guide to Clearer Signals
Are you tired of fuzzy TV channels or weak radio reception? A UHF antenna can make a big difference. UHF stands for Ultra High Frequency. These signals are used for over-the-air television broadcasting and some radio communications. Getting the right UHF antenna means you’ll enjoy better picture and sound quality. Key Features to Look For
When you shop for a UHF antenna, keep these important features in mind:
- Gain: This tells you how well the antenna can pick up signals. Higher gain means a stronger signal. Look for antennas with a gain of 10 dB or more for better performance.
- Beamwidth: This is the angle at which the antenna receives signals best. A narrower beamwidth focuses on signals from one direction. This is good if you know where your broadcast towers are. A wider beamwidth picks up signals from more directions. This is helpful if towers are scattered.
- Impedance: Most modern TVs and devices use 75-ohm impedance. Make sure the antenna matches this. Many antennas come with adapters to connect to different cable types.
- Durability: If you plan to use the antenna outdoors, it needs to withstand weather. Look for antennas made with strong, weather-resistant materials.
- Mounting Options: Consider how and where you’ll install the antenna. Some are designed for rooftops, others for attics or balconies. Make sure the mounting hardware is included or easily available.
Important Materials
The materials used in an antenna affect its performance and lifespan.
- Aluminum: This is a common and good choice for antenna elements. It’s lightweight and conducts signals well.
- Copper: While more expensive, copper is an excellent conductor. You might find copper wiring inside the antenna for better signal transfer.
- UV-Resistant Plastics: These protect the antenna from sun damage. They keep the antenna from becoming brittle and breaking over time.
- Steel: Used for mounting brackets and poles. It needs to be strong to hold the antenna steady, especially in windy conditions.
Factors That Improve or Reduce Quality
Several things can make your antenna work better or worse.
- Antenna Placement: This is super important!
- Higher is Better: The higher you mount the antenna, the fewer things block the signal. Trees, buildings, and hills can all interfere.
- Clear Line of Sight: Try to have a clear path between your antenna and the broadcast towers.
- Avoid Interference: Keep the antenna away from electrical devices like microwaves, Wi-Fi routers, and fluorescent lights. These can create “noise” that messes with your signal.
- Cable Quality:
- Use Good Cables: Use high-quality coaxial cables (like RG6). Cheap cables can lose signal strength.
- Keep Cables Short: The longer the cable, the more signal you lose. Use the shortest cable possible to connect your antenna to your TV.
- Antenna Design:
- Directional vs. Omnidirectional: Directional antennas are great if you know where the towers are. Omnidirectional antennas pick up signals from all around.
- Active vs. Passive: Active antennas have a built-in amplifier. These can boost weak signals, but they can also amplify noise if the signal is already strong. Passive antennas don’t have an amplifier.

Frequently Asked Questions (FAQ) about UHF Antennas
Q: What is the main purpose of a UHF antenna?
A: The main purpose of a UHF antenna is to receive Ultra High Frequency signals. These signals are used for over-the-air television broadcasts.
Q: How does antenna “gain” affect my signal?
A: Antenna gain measures how well the antenna picks up signals. Higher gain means the antenna can capture a stronger signal, leading to a clearer picture and sound.
Q: Should I get a directional or omnidirectional antenna?
A: If you know the direction of the TV broadcast towers, a directional antenna is often better. If towers are in many different directions, an omnidirectional antenna might be a good choice.
Q: Does the material of the antenna really matter?
A: Yes, the material matters. Aluminum and copper are good for conducting signals. UV-resistant plastics help the antenna last longer outdoors.
Q: Can I use any TV antenna for UHF signals?
A: Not all antennas are designed for UHF. You need to make sure the antenna is specifically designed or advertised to receive UHF frequencies for TV reception.
Q: How high should I mount my UHF antenna?
A: The higher you mount your antenna, the better. This helps avoid obstacles like trees and buildings that can block the signal.
Q: What is “impedance” and why is it important?
A: Impedance is a measure of electrical resistance. Most TVs expect a 75-ohm impedance, so your antenna should match this for the best connection.
Q: Will a longer cable weaken my TV signal?
A: Yes, a longer cable can weaken your TV signal. It’s best to use the shortest, high-quality coaxial cable possible.
Q: What is an “active” antenna?
A: An active antenna has a built-in amplifier. This can help boost weak signals, but it might also boost unwanted noise.
